第二章 关系数据库

关系数据库由关系数据结构、关系操作集合和关系完整性约束构成。候选码是能唯一标识元组的属性组,主码是选定的候选码。实体和联系通过关系表示,关系模式包括关系名、属性名等。实体完整性规则规定主属性不能取空值,参照完整性规则涉及外码。关系数据库系统以表为唯一结构,区别于非关系数据库。SQL是关系数据库的语言,具备关系代数和关系演算双重特点,视图提供数据抽象和安全性。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

  1. 关系模型:关系数据结构、关系操作集合和关系完整性约束三部分组成
  2. :一组具有相同类型的值的集合
  3. 基数:一个域允许的不同取值个数称为这个域的基数
  4. 候选码:关系中某一属性组的值能够唯一的标识一个元组,而其子集不能,则称该属性组为候选码
    候选码的诸属性称为主属性,不包含在任何候选码中的属性称为非主属性或非码属性
  5. 主码:若一个关系有多个候选码,则选定其中一个为主码
  6. 全码:最极端的情况下,整个属性组是码,称为全码
  7. 元组和记录是同一概念
  8. 实体以及实体之间的联系都是用关系来表示的
  9. 关系的描述称为关系模式
  10. 一个关系模式的定义:主要包括关系名、属性名、属性类型、属性长度和        关键字
  11. 关系数据库的型:也称为关系数据库模式,是对关系数据库的描述
  12. 关系数据库的值:是这些关系模式在某一时刻对应的关系的集合
  13. 实体完整性规则:若属性A是基本关系R的主属性,则A不能取空值
  14. 参照完整性规则;若属性F是基本关系R的外码,它与基本关系S的主码Ks相对应,则对于R中每个元组在F上的值必须:或者取空值;或者等于S中某个元组的主码值
  15. 用户定义的完整性
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

南淮北安

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值